Nam Kyung-eup to star in MBC drama "Good People"

Actor Nam Kyung-eup is starring in the new MBC drama "Good People".

Taepoong Entertainment claimed he's starring in the drama as Cha Man-goo, the executive director of Daeyeong Group.
"Good People" is a drama about being hurt and comforted by people at the same time and realizing there's hope in them.
Nam Kyung-eup's role of Cha Man-goo is one who has a place in the company thanks to his CEO sister Cha Ok-sim and keeps check of Seung-hee, his adopted niece. He depends on his young daughter for everything and is easily shaken by the wind.
Nam Kyung-eup starred in the JTBC drama "My Love Eun-dong" as a cold, heartless father. Unlike his previous character, Nam is a dependable and loving father to his daughter in "Good People".
"Good People" is programmed for May.
